Abstract

This study aims to determine the effect of leadership style implementation on work discipline as a moderating variable, to examine the effect of work motivation on work discipline as a moderating variable, to analyze the influence of leadership style and work motivation on personnel performance, and to assess work discipline as a moderating variable affecting personnel performance in the Mobile Brigade Corps Unit of the Indonesian National Police. This research uses a quantitative approach. The population studied consists of 1,327 Mobile Brigade personnel in the Mobile Brigade Corps Unit, Kelapa Dua, Depok, West Java. The sampling technique used is Probability Sampling with the Simple Random Sampling method. The sample size was calculated using the Slovin formula, resulting in 95 respondents. Data collection techniques employed in this study include questionnaire distribution and observation. The data analysis technique used is the SPSS version 20 program.The results of the study show that: (1) There is no significant influence of the Leadership Style variable (X1) on Work Discipline (M) in the Mobile Brigade Corps Unit of the Indonesian National Police. This is evidenced by a path coefficient of 0.076 with a t-count value of 1.982 and a t-table value of 1.985, where 1.982 < 1.985 with a probability of 0.050. (2) There is a significant influence of the Work Motivation variable (X2) on Work Discipline (M) in the Mobile Brigade Corps Unit of the Indonesian National Police. This is proven by a path coefficient of 0.908 with a t-count value of 23.736 and a t-table value of 1.985, where 23.736 > 1.985 with a probability of 0.000 (0.000 < 0.05). (3) There is a significant influence of the Leadership Style (X1) and Work Motivation (X2) variables on Personnel Performance (Y) in the Mobile Brigade Corps Unit of the Indonesian National Police. This is demonstrated by an F-count value of 48.095 and an F-table value of 2.70, where 48.095 > 2.70 with a probability of 0.000 (0.000 < 0.05). (4) There is a significant influence of the Work Discipline variable (M) on Personnel Performance (Y) in the Mobile Brigade Corps Unit of the Indonesian National Police. This is indicated by a path coefficient of 0.982 with a t-count value of 4.779 and a t-table value of 1.985, where 4.779 > 1.985 with a probability of 0.000 (0.000 < 0.05).

Abstract

This study aims to analyze the influence of communication and organizational culture on employee performance at the Insan Cendekia Madani School Office, South Tangerang. Specifically, the objectives are: (1) to examine the effect of communication on employee performance; (2) to examine the effect of organizational culture on employee performance; and (3) to examine the simultaneous effect of communication and organizational culture on employee performance. This research adopts a quantitative approach with a descriptive and associative research design. The population consists of employees at the Insan Cendekia Madani School Office, South Tangerang, with a sample of 83 respondents selected using Slovin’s formula. The results show that: (1) communication has a significant effect on employee performance, as indicated by a t-count value of 4.726, which exceeds the t-table value of 1.663; (2) organizational culture has a significant effect on employee performance, as shown by a t-count value of 73.536, which exceeds the t-table value of 1.663; and (3) communication and organizational culture simultaneously have a significant positive effect on employee performance, as demonstrated by an ANOVA test with an F-count of 21.631, exceeding the F-table value of 2.71 at a significance level of 0.000 (< 0.05). These findings suggest that strengthening internal communication and fostering a positive organizational culture contribute significantly to improving employee performance.
